What is a data entry home based?

A Data Entry Home Based job involves inputting, updating, and managing data using a computer while working remotely. Tasks may include typing information from physical or digital documents into databases, spreadsheets, or content management systems. Accuracy, attention to detail, and typing speed are essential for this role. Many companies hire remote data entry workers for administrative tasks, record-keeping, and document processing.

What are some typical challenges faced by home-based data entry professionals and how can they be managed?

Home-based data entry professionals often face challenges such as maintaining focus in a non-traditional work environment, managing potential distractions, and ensuring consistent internet connectivity. To overcome these, it’s important to set up a dedicated workspace, establish a structured daily routine, and regularly back up data to prevent losses. Clear communication with supervisors and timely reporting also help maintain workflow and address any issues promptly. By proactively managing these challenges, remote data entry clerks can maintain high productivity and job satisfaction.

Job description

JOB DESCRIPTION
RN VISITING STAFF
Provides hands on care to each assigned patient. Supervises and teaches team members, including RN's, LPN's and HHA'a in the efficient and effective delivery of quality patient care.
Q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Registered Professional Nurse, currently licensed in the state of Tennessee.
  • Current valid driver's license.
  • Must be able to provide direct patient care and take on-call.
  • Working knowledge of the home health care program and previous experience providing home health visits preferred.
  • Computer data entry and word processing skills desirable.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
  1. Accepts patient care reports and patient assignments from the RN Team Leader for all patients assigned. Coordinates with the RN Team Leader timely completion of assigned visits and submission of the required documentation.

  1. Obtains a weekly visiting schedule for all assigned patients and conducts visits according to the schedule. Contacts the RN Team Leader on a daily basis for any changes to the schedule.

  1. Notifies the RN Team Leader of any anticipated problems with the posted schedule. Provides as much advance notice of changes/problems as is possible.

  1. Establishes and maintains an effective and efficient visit route and provides direct patient care in compliance with the plan of care.

  1. Provides frequent communication to the RN Team Leader, physicians, other team members, etc., and the patient/family in efforts to coordinate changes in patient care and assures appropriate follow-up and supporting documentation is done. This includes but is not limited to; lab reports, on-call/prn visits, transfer to ER or in-patient facility admission, etc.

  1. Assists the RN Team Leader in the maintenance of a complete and accurate calendar book, including disaster codes, emergency information, due dates for lab work, etc.

  1. Assigns, develops, supervises and evaluates personal care services provided by the Home Health Aide in accordance with organizational policies, procedures and processes and Medicare/ State regulations. Develops and revises, when indicated, the personal care-care plan for each patient receiving Home Health Aide visits.

  1. Assigns, develops, supervises and evaluates nursing services provided by the Licensed Practical Nurse in accordance with the plan of care, organizational policies, procedures and processes and applicable regulation(s).

  1. Makes assigned patient care visits in accordance with physician orders. Completes supporting documentation in an accurate and timely manner, including but not limited to; visit report, OASIS assessment, care plan/plan of care revisions, medication profile, progress notes, revisions to the plan of treatment for recertification, discharge/transfer summary, etc.

  1. Is available and makes prn and routine patient visits when indicated and as requested. Is available and rotates on-call assignments when requested.

  1. Attends team conferences for all patients assigned to the nurse. Participates and offers input regarding each patient's care and progress toward individual patient goals. Assists the RN Team Leader in documenting above information and providing a progress report to the physician every 60 days.
